  • This is the iRule solution which do the same as my policy... except...

     

    • policy condition is not case sensitive by default... irule is... we need to use string tolower to compare lowercase strings..
    • you specify "contains" in condition, i choose "equals"

    When a question is like this one, I think the policies are easier than irules to understand and configure...

     

    Most of my deployments use both irules and policies:

     

    • policies to manage URL-based rules (redirects, pool assignments header replace, define tcl variables to be used by irules executed after) and rules with source IPs conditions (since 11.6)
    • irules to manage complexe needs...

    The main goal of this is when changing irules, there is a risk of TCL error if something is wrong... so when there is a new need for a specific URL, the administrator can modify the policy easily and safer.
